Silverton Mountain
Nature
Silverton Mountain, in Colorado’s San Juan Mountains near Silverton, opened in 2002 as a deliberately low-impact ski area focused on steep, ungroomed terrain for advanced and expert skiers and snowboarders. At 13,487 feet, it is identified as North America’s highest ski area and operates with a single chairlift, no groomed runs, and terrain reached by both lift and hiking. Avalanche safety is central, with required rescue gear and periods of guided-only skiing. Beyond its lift-served area, it also provides access to extensive hike-to and helicopter-accessed terrain. Its stark, ski-centered model made it distinctive in American skiing, though its history has also included a fatal accident in 2012.
